Abstract:
The article explores the possibilities of using information and communication technologies (ICT) in the career guidance work of future vocational education teachers. It outlines contemporary challenges related to the increasing demands for youth’s professional self-determination and the necessity of integrating these technologies into the education system.
The focus is placed on ICT as a crucial tool for enhancing the effectiveness of career guidance activities by ensuring accessibility, personalization, and interactivity in professional counseling. The study proves that the use of ICT contributes to a deeper understanding of modern labor market requirements, enabling students to make informed career choices and adapt to the changing economic landscape.
It has been determined that, in the context of education digitalization, career guidance activities are increasingly shifting to the online space. ICT opens up extensive opportunities for future vocational education teachers, allowing them to utilize various digital tools to support young people in making conscious career decisions. Through interactive platforms, specialized web resources, and artificial intelligence, educators can conduct diagnostic testing, organize virtual meetings with industry professionals, and provide access to up-to-date information on labor market trends and promising industry developments.
The article presents an overview of Ukrainian and international online platforms that can be effectively used for career guidance, along with practical recommendations for their integration into the educational process.
In addition to the advantages, the study also identifies key challenges associated with using ICT in career guidance, including the issue of digital inequality, the need for improved methodological support, and risks related to information security and personal data protection.
In conclusion, the article emphasizes that integrating information and communication technologies into the career guidance work of future vocational education teachers significantly increases its effectiveness. It fosters the development of independent career decision-making skills, prepares students for conscious career planning, and facilitates their adaptation to the demands of the modern labor market.
